本教程详细介绍 Codex 与 Claude Code 在 Windows、Mac、Linux 三大主流操作系统上的安装与配置方法两款工具均通过 xuedingmao.com 站点进行 API 调用配置。第一部分Codex 安装与配置教程Windows 版本教程系统要求Windows 10 或 Windows 11Node.js 22npm 10网络连接安装步骤前置步骤安装 Git Bash请访问 Git - Downloads 下载对应您电脑系统的版本之后一直点击下一步即可完成安装。1. 安装 Node.js访问 Node.js 官网 下载并安装最新 LTS 版本。2. 安装 codex打开命令提示符 (CMD) 或 PowerShell运行npminstall-gopenai/codex3. 验证安装打开命令提示符 (CMD) 或 PowerShell运行codex--version配置 API1. 获取 Auth Token访问 xuedingmao.com 站点页面进行以下操作点击控制台 → API令牌页面点击添加令牌令牌分组请选择codex专属务必选择此分组否则无法使用令牌名称随意额度建议设置为无限额度其他选项保持默认2. 配置文件重要提示请将下方的sk-xxx替换为您在 xuedingmao.com 生成的实际 API 密钥重要提示请将下方的sk-xxx替换为您在 xuedingmao.com 生成的实际 API 密钥重要提示请将下方的sk-xxx替换为您在 xuedingmao.com 生成的实际 API 密钥进入当前用户的用户目录下的.codex文件夹中例如C:\Users\testuser\.codex。注意如果看不到该目录说明您没有打开 Windows 的显示隐藏的项目请先在文件资源管理器中开启。如果没有.codex文件夹请手动创建该文件夹然后在其中创建config.toml以及auth.json两个文件。填写配置需要将sk-xxx替换成您自己创建的真实 SK。a.auth.json中的配置{OPENAI_API_KEY:sk-xxx}b.config.toml中的配置直接粘贴下面的内容即可model_reasoning_effort可选值为high,medium,low分别代表模型思考的努力程度高、中、低。model_provider api111 model gpt-5-codex model_reasoning_effort high disable_response_storage true preferred_auth_method apikey [model_providers.api111] name api111 base_url https://xuedingmao.com/v1 wire_api responses启动 codex重启终端重启终端重启终端然后进入到您的工程目录cdyour-project-folder运行以下命令启动codexVSCode 插件 codex以上配置完成后在 VSCode 扩展商店中搜索并安装codex即可。安装完成后会出现在侧边栏。Mac 版本教程系统要求macOS 12 或更高版本Node.js 22npm 10网络连接安装步骤1. 安装 Node.js方式一直接访问 Node.js 官网 下载并安装最新 LTS 版本。方式二使用 Homebrew推荐# 如果尚未安装 Homebrew请先运行此命令/bin/bash-c$(curl-fsSLhttps://raw.githubusercontent.com/Homebrew/install/HEAD/install.sh)# 安装 Node.jsbrewinstallnode2. 安装 codex打开终端 (Terminal)运行可能需要加sudonpminstall-gopenai/codex3. 验证安装打开终端 (Terminal)运行codex--version配置 API1. 获取 Auth Token访问 xuedingmao.com 站点页面进行以下操作点击控制台 → API令牌页面点击添加令牌令牌分组请选择codex专属务必选择此分组否则无法使用令牌名称随意额度建议设置为无限额度其他选项保持默认2. 配置文件重要提示请将下方的sk-xxx替换为您在 xuedingmao.com 生成的实际 API 密钥重要提示请将下方的sk-xxx替换为您在 xuedingmao.com 生成的实际 API 密钥重要提示请将下方的sk-xxx替换为您在 xuedingmao.com 生成的实际 API 密钥创建目录和文件mkdir-p~/.codextouch~/.codex/auth.jsontouch~/.codex/config.toml编辑auth.json文件vi~/.codex/auth.json按i进入插入模式粘贴以下内容将sk-xxx替换为您的密钥然后按ESC键输入:wq并回车保存退出。{OPENAI_API_KEY:sk-xxx}编辑config.toml文件vi~/.codex/config.toml按i进入插入模式粘贴以下内容然后按ESC键输入:wq并回车保存退出。model_provider api111 model gpt-5-codex model_reasoning_effort high disable_response_storage true preferred_auth_method apikey [model_providers.api111] name api111 base_url https://xuedingmao.com/v1 wire_api responses启动 codex重启终端重启终端重启终端然后进入到您的工程目录cdyour-project-folder运行以下命令启动codexVSCode 插件 codex以上配置完成后在 VSCode 扩展商店中搜索并安装codex即可。安装完成后会出现在侧边栏。Linux 版本教程系统要求主流 Linux 发行版 (Ubuntu 20.04, Debian 10, CentOS 7, etc.)Node.js 22npm 10网络连接安装步骤1. 安装 Node.jsUbuntu/Debiansudoaptupdatecurl-fsSLhttps://deb.nodesource.com/setup_lts.x|sudo-Ebash-sudoapt-getinstall-ynodejsCentOS/RHEL/Fedora# 使用 dnf (Fedora) 或 yum (CentOS/RHEL)sudodnfinstallnodejsnpm# 或sudoyuminstallnodejsnpmArch Linuxsudopacman-Snodejsnpm2. 安装 codex打开终端 (Terminal)运行sudonpminstall-gopenai/codex3. 验证安装打开终端 (Terminal)运行codex--version配置 API1. 获取 Auth Token访问 xuedingmao.com 站点页面进行以下操作点击控制台 → API令牌页面点击添加令牌令牌分组请选择codex渠道-gpt务必选择此分组否则无法使用令牌名称随意额度建议设置为无限额度其他选项保持默认2. 配置文件重要提示请将下方的sk-xxx替换为您在 xuedingmao.com 生成的实际 API 密钥重要提示请将下方的sk-xxx替换为您在 xuedingmao.com 生成的实际 API 密钥重要提示请将下方的sk-xxx替换为您在 xuedingmao.com 生成的实际 API 密钥创建目录和文件mkdir-p~/.codextouch~/.codex/auth.jsontouch~/.codex/config.toml编辑auth.json文件vi~/.codex/auth.json按i进入插入模式粘贴以下内容将sk-xxx替换为您的密钥然后按ESC键输入:wq并回车保存退出。{OPENAI_API_KEY:sk-xxx}编辑config.toml文件vi~/.codex/config.toml按i进入插入模式粘贴以下内容然后按ESC键输入:wq并回车保存退出。model_provider api111 model gpt-5-codex model_reasoning_effort high disable_response_storage true preferred_auth_method apikey [model_providers.api111] name api111 base_url https://xuedingmao.com/v1 wire_api responses启动 codex重启终端重启终端重启终端然后进入到您的工程目录cdyour-project-folder运行以下命令启动codexVSCode 插件 codex以上配置完成后在 VSCode 扩展商店中搜索并安装codex即可。安装完成后会出现在侧边栏。Codex 常见问题出现错误请按照如下步骤排查确认 API Key 创建是否正确额度选择无限额度不要限制模型分组选择codex渠道-gpt。更多 codex 配置及使用详情请参考codex 官方教程。第二部分Claude Code 安装使用教程Claude Code 是一个强大的 AI 编程助手让您可以直接在终端中与 AI 协作编程。本教程将指导您完成安装和配置过程。系统要求Node.js 版本 ≥ 18.0支持的操作系统macOS、Linux、Windows (WSL)快速开始1. 安装 Node.js提示如果您已经安装了 Node.js 18.0 或更高版本可以跳过此步骤。Ubuntu / Debian 用户# 安装 Node.js LTS 版本curl-fsSLhttps://deb.nodesource.com/setup_lts.x|sudobash-sudoapt-getinstall-ynodejs# 验证安装node--versionmacOS 用户# 安装 Xcode 命令行工具sudoxcode-select--install# 安装 Homebrew如果尚未安装/bin/bash-c$(curl-fsSLhttps://raw.githubusercontent.com/Homebrew/install/HEAD/install.sh)# 通过 Homebrew 安装 Node.jsbrewinstallnode# 验证安装node--version2. 安装 Claude Code使用 npm 全局安装 Claude Codenpminstall-ganthropic-ai/claude-code# 验证安装claude--version3. 配置并开始使用获取必要的配置信息您需要准备两个重要的配置项配置项说明获取方式ANTHROPIC_AUTH_TOKENAPI 认证令牌注册后在API令牌页面点击添加令牌获得以sk-开头ANTHROPIC_BASE_URLAPI 服务地址使用https://xuedingmao.com与主站地址相同创建令牌时的建议设置名称随意命名额度设为无限额度分组选择Claude code专属或者官转克劳德3及以上其他选项保持默认设置启动 Claude Code在您的项目目录下运行Linux/Unix 系统# 进入项目目录cdyour-project-folder# 设置环境变量exportANTHROPIC_AUTH_TOKENsk-...# 替换为您的实际令牌exportANTHROPIC_BASE_URLhttps://xuedingmao.comexportAPI_TIMEOUT_MS300000# 设置为 300 秒超时# 启动 Claude CodeclaudeWindows PowerShell 系统# 进入项目目录cd your-project-folder# 设置环境变量$env:ANTHROPIC_BASE_URL https://xuedingmao.com$env:ANTHROPIC_AUTH_TOKEN sk-...# 替换为您的实际令牌$env:API_TIMEOUT_MS 300000# 设置为 300 秒超时# 启动 Claude CodeclaudeWindows CMD 系统# 进入项目目录 cd your-project-folder # 设置环境变量 set ANTHROPIC_BASE_URLhttps://xuedingmao.com set ANTHROPIC_AUTH_TOKENsk-... # 替换为您的实际令牌 set API_TIMEOUT_MS300000 # 设置为 300 秒超时 # 启动 Claude Code claude初次运行配置启动后您将看到以下配置步骤选择主题→ 选择您喜欢的主题 按 Enter安全须知→ 确认安全须知 按 EnterTerminal 配置→ 使用默认配置 按 Enter工作目录信任→ 信任当前目录 按 Enter✨恭喜现在您可以开始与您的 AI 编程搭档一起写代码了常见问题解答Q: 遇到 “Invalid API Key · Please run /login” 错误A:这表明 Claude Code 未检测到环境变量。请检查是否正确设置了ANTHROPIC_AUTH_TOKEN和ANTHROPIC_BASE_URL环境变量值是否正确令牌以sk-开头如果使用了永久配置是否重启了终端Q: 为什么显示 “offline” 状态A:Claude Code 通过连接 Google 来判断网络状态。显示 “offline” 不影响正常使用只是表明无法连接到 Google。Q: 为什么浏览网页的 Fetch 会失败A:Claude Code 在访问网页前需要调用 Claude 服务进行安全检查。您需要保持稳定的国际互联网连接必要时使用全局代理Q: 请求总是显示 “fetch failed”A:可能是网络环境导致的问题。解决方案尝试使用代理工具Q: API 报错如何处理A:可能是转发代理不稳定导致的建议退出 Claude CodeCtrlC重新运行claude命令如果问题持续请稍后再试Q: 网页登录错误A:尝试清除本站的 Cookie然后重新登录。注意事项本站在 xuedingmao.com 直接接入官方 Claude Code 转发服务仅支持 Claude Code 的 API 流量不支持其他 API 调用请妥善保管您的 API 令牌避免泄露相关链接Claude Code 官方文档Node.js 官方网站提示如遇到其他问题请查看官方文档或联系技术支持。